Quellcodebibliothek Statistik Leitseite products/Sources/formale Sprachen/Cobol/Test-Suite/SQL M/     Datei vom 4.1.2008 mit Größe 1 kB image not shown  

Quelle  cdr031.mco   Sprache: unbekannt

 
-- SQL Test Suite, V6.0, SQL Module cdr031.mco
-- 59-byte ID
-- 
MODULE CDR031
LANGUAGE COBOL
AUTHORIZATION FLATER



PROCEDURE SUB1 SQLCODE SQLSTATE
    :UIDX CHAR(18);
      SELECT USER INTO :UIDX FROM SUN.ECCO;

PROCEDURE SUB2 SQLCODE SQLSTATE
    :VTR119 CHAR(118);
      INSERT INTO SUN.T6118REF VALUES
                    ('AAAAAAAAAAAAAAAAAAAA', 'BBBBBBBBBBBBBBBBBBBB',
                    'CCCCCCCCCCCCCCCCCCCC', 'DDDDDDDDDDDDDDDDDDDD',
                    'EEEEEEEEEEEEEEEEEEEEEEE', 9999, :VTR119);

PROCEDURE SUB3 SQLCODE SQLSTATE;
      INSERT INTO SUN.T6 VALUES
                    ('AAAAAAAAAAAAAAAAAAAA', 'BBBBBBBBBBBBBBBBBBBB',
                    'CCCCCCCCCCCCCCCCCCCC', 'DDDDDDDDDDDDDDDDDDDD',
                    'EEEEEEEEEEEEEEEEEEEEEEE', 9999);

PROCEDURE SUB4 SQLCODE SQLSTATE
    :VTR119 CHAR(118);
      INSERT INTO SUN.T118 VALUES (:VTR119);

PROCEDURE SUB5 SQLCODE SQLSTATE;
      INSERT INTO SUN.T6 VALUES
                    ('AAAAAAAAAAAAAAAAAAAA', 'BBBBBBBBBBBBBBBBBBBB',
                    'CCCCCCCCCCCCCCCCCCCC', 'DDDDDDDDDDDDDDDDDDDD',
                    'EEEEEEEEEEEEEEEEEEEEEEE', 0);

PROCEDURE SUB6 SQLCODE SQLSTATE;
      INSERT INTO SUN.T118 VALUES ('Hamlet');

PROCEDURE SUB7 SQLCODE SQLSTATE;
      ROLLBACK WORK;

PROCEDURE SUB8 SQLCODE SQLSTATE;
      INSERT INTO SUN.TESTREPORT
                      VALUES('0526','pass','MCO');

PROCEDURE SUB9 SQLCODE SQLSTATE;
      INSERT INTO SUN.TESTREPORT
                      VALUES('0526','fail','MCO');

PROCEDURE SUB10 SQLCODE SQLSTATE;
      COMMIT WORK;

[ Dauer der Verarbeitung: 0.20 Sekunden  (vorverarbeitet)  ]